Exterior Painting and Wood Rot Repair Cost in Kansas City

The cost changes when exterior painting includes damaged trim, fascia, siding details, or other wood repair before the finish coat.

What Changes the Cost?

Repair-before-painting projects depend on condition, access, and prep

Amount of Damaged Wood

A few trim spots cost less than widespread fascia, siding detail, or deck-adjacent repairs.

Access and Height

Upper trim, roof-edge fascia, and difficult access areas can add time and setup.

Prep and Primer

Scraping, sanding, caulking, spot priming, and drying time affect the schedule.

Paint Scope

Whole-home painting, trim-only work, accent changes, and coating choice all change the final scope.

Typical Timeline Factors

The exact timeline depends on scope, weather, and repair needs

Exterior review and estimate
Walk the home, identify visible wood concerns, review paint condition, and discuss goals.
Repair and prep
Address damaged wood, scrape, sand, caulk, and spot prime before finish coats.
Painting and walkthrough
Apply exterior coating system, clean up, and review the finished work.
